The Interventional Radiology Advanced Practice Provider (IR APP) Fellowship is a comprehensive, 12-month post-graduate training program designed to equip early-career Nurse Practitioners (NPs) and Physician Assistants (PAs) with the clinical and procedural expertise necessary to excel in the dynamic field of Interventional Radiology (IR).
This immersive fellowship bridges the gap between general APP education and the specialized demands of IR, offering a structured curriculum that encompasses hands-on procedural training, didactic instruction, and direct clinical experience. Fellows will work closely with experienced interventional radiology APP’s and Physicians, and multidisciplinary teams to develop proficiency across a wide range of image-guided procedures and peri-procedural patient care.
Due to the steep learning curve in IR—which integrates advanced procedural skills with complex clinical care—this fellowship is designed to offer the focused time, mentorship, and resources necessary for APPs to succeed in this high-acuity specialty.
Upon completion of the program, fellows will be credentialed for IR procedures and will have the competence and confidence to contribute meaningfully in both academic and community IR environments.
The full contract is a 2-year commitment for the APP fellow. The fellowship is a 1-year program with fellowship pay. The second year, you will be hired as an Instructor with pay determined based on the APP salary grid hiring scale. Additional details will be provided during the interview process.

A salary of $72,953 will be provided to all fellows over the course of the 12-month program.
Additional benefits include medical insurance, dental insurance, and eye insurance.
Paid time off: To request vacation time, you must send your request to the program director at the start of the fellowship year and as needed throughout the year. Requests will be granted to the extent possible with the IR APP schedule.
Holidays: No call requirements, holidays are off.
Unplanned absences: Unplanned absences should be kept to a minimum. If you are unable to make it to work for personal circumstances, it is your responsibility to immediately notify the program director on your service as soon as possible.
Continuing Medical 麻豆传媒高清: Graduates can be expected 50+ hours of CME at the completion of their APP fellowship. APP fellows are also encouraged to attend local and national IR conferences as available.

Upon graduating, the fellow will receive a certificate from 麻豆传媒高清 University School of Medicine which verifies that they have completed all components outlined in the curriculum and have achieved program competencies. The fellow will be credentialed in multiple procedures will obtain fluoroscopy certification.

Who should I address my cover letter/personal statement to?
You are welcome to address your letters and have your recommenders address letters to “Advanced Practice Fellowship Selection Committee”.
Can I apply during my last semester of training, prior to having licensure exam results?
Yes, you can be accepted into the program before your graduation as long as you have taken and passed your exam 60 days prior to starting the fellowship.
I’m an FNP/ENP, can I still apply and be considered, even if I have significant ER/hospital work experience?
Unfortunately, we are not able to accept any NPs other than credentialed ACNPs/AGNP's into the fellowship. Since our fellows rotate
on services through the University of 麻豆传媒高清 Hospital, we must adhere to their guidelines and they are currently only accepting ACNPs/AGNP's as employees in the inpatient setting as set by national guidelines.
How many applicants are accepted each year?
One APP fellow is selected per year.
If I apply, when will I be notified of final acceptance/denial?
We aim to notify applicants by August 1st.
Do you have to be credentialed in the state of 麻豆传媒高清 to apply?
No. Once applicants are accepted, we will help you navigate the credentialing process prior to the program start date.
What are you looking for in candidates?
We look for candidates who express a high interest in procedural based practices and IR, including pre-operative and post operative management. You do not have to have previous experience in IR to apply for the
position.
